Obtaining Dubai Civil Defense Approval for Construction Projects

The method of obtaining Dubai Civil Defense approval concerning construction projects requires a essential step in ensuring the safety and conformity with local building codes. Before commencement of any construction activities, developers must submit detailed plans and information to the Dubai Civil Defense office for review and approval. This comprehensive review process covers a wide range of factors, including fire safety, structural integrity, mobility , and emergency response plans.

  • Furthermore, the Dubai Civil Defense may conduct on-site inspections to confirm that construction works are in agreement with approved plans and building codes.
  • Following successful completion of the review process, developers will be granted a license from the Dubai Civil Defense, allowing them to proceed with construction.

Obtaining DCD Approval in Dubai: Requirements and Application Process

Planning to erect a project in Dubai? Securing the necessary approvals is crucial. The Dubai Civil Defense (DCD) approval is one of license required for construction projects. Understanding the criteria and submission process can greatly ease your journey.

To commence the DCD approval process, you'll need to submit a thorough form that contains detailed project plans, structural drawings, fire safety systems, and other applicable documents.

  • Verify your drawings adhere to the Dubai Building Code and regulations.
  • Collaborate a licensed fire safety consultant to ensure compliance.
  • Scrutinize the DCD website for detailed information on criteria.

The DCD assesses your application and conducts site inspections. Once granted, you'll receive a DCD approval certificate.
